What affects the price

Plumbing costs change based on the complexity of the repair and the accessibility of the pipes. If a pro needs to cut into drywall or dig underground to reach a leak, the labor time increases. Older homes sometimes require updating outdated materials, like galvanized steel, to meet current codes. The timing of the service also matters, as after-hours or holiday calls often carry different rates than standard business hours. While simple drain clearings or fixture swaps are usually on the lower end, larger system repipes cost more.

What are common reasons for a toilet clog in Columbus?

Toilet clogs in Columbus can stem from several issues. Flushing too much toilet paper or non-flushable items is a primary culprit. In older homes in areas like Olde Towne East, tree roots can sometimes infiltrate sewer lines, causing blockages. Improperly vented plumbing systems can also lead to slow drains and clogs. What causes burst pipes, and how quickly can a plumber fix them in Columbus?

Burst pipes in Columbus are often caused by freezing temperatures, which can be a concern during Ohio winters. Corrosion and high water pressure can also lead to pipe failure.
